Personalized Care That Fits Your Needs

 

At Tyler Home Care, we understand that every individual and family has different needs. That’s why our non-medical care plans are flexible and personalized to provide the right level of support for each client.

 

Our caregivers can assist with:

 

Personal hygiene and grooming

Medication reminders

Meal preparation

Light housekeeping

Assistance with Activities of Daily Living (ADLs)

Transportation to and from medical appointments

Companionship and social support

Assistance with everyday household tasks

 

We also provide trained and certified caregivers with specialized experience in Alzheimer’s disease and dementia care, offering families additional peace of mind when their loved one requires specialized support.
